Porcelain Tile Installation in Española Way

Porcelain is the Florida workhorse — low-absorption, dense, stain-resistant, and flood-recoverable. Because it absorbs 0.5% water or less, it shrugs off humidity, standing water, and salt air. We verify true porcelain, test the slab, and set it over an uncoupling membrane to TCNA standards so it survives the slab and the storms.
